Nutritional provisions specifically formulated for canines engaged in strenuous activities, such as tracking and retrieving game, represent a distinct category within the broader pet food market. These specialized diets are designed to meet the elevated energy demands and unique physiological requirements of working animals. An example is a formula with a higher protein and fat content than standard maintenance diets, supporting muscle development and endurance.

The provision of appropriate nourishment significantly impacts a hunting dog’s performance, stamina, and overall health. Optimal nutrition aids in maintaining peak physical condition, promoting faster recovery after periods of intense activity, and minimizing the risk of injury. Historically, working dogs were often fed table scraps or generic feed, leading to nutritional deficiencies. The development of specialized diets reflects a growing understanding of canine physiology and the impact of targeted nutrition on working performance.

Considerations for Canine Field Nutrition

Ensuring optimal performance and well-being of canine athletes requires careful attention to their dietary needs. The following recommendations provide guidance for selecting and managing nutritional intake.

Tip 1: Prioritize Protein Content: Diets should contain a high percentage of animal-based protein to support muscle development and repair, crucial for sustained physical exertion. Look for formulations where meat is listed as the primary ingredient.

Tip 2: Evaluate Fat Sources: Dietary fat serves as a concentrated energy source for sustained activity. Omega-3 and Omega-6 fatty acids contribute to joint health and coat condition, beneficial for working canines exposed to various environmental conditions.

Tip 3: Monitor Caloric Intake: Adjust portion sizes based on the dog’s activity level and body condition score. Overfeeding can lead to decreased agility and increased risk of injury, while underfeeding may result in fatigue and reduced performance.

Tip 4: Time Feeding Strategically: Provide meals several hours before or after periods of intense activity to optimize digestion and energy availability. Avoid feeding immediately prior to strenuous exercise to minimize the risk of bloat or digestive upset.

Tip 5: Supplement with Caution: Consult with a veterinarian before introducing any dietary supplements. While some supplements may offer potential benefits, others may interact negatively with the primary diet or pose health risks.

Tip 6: Hydration is Critical: Ensure consistent access to fresh, clean water, especially during periods of intense activity. Dehydration can significantly impair performance and increase the risk of heatstroke.

Tip 7: Transition Gradually: When switching to a new formula, implement a gradual transition to minimize digestive upset. Slowly introduce the new formula while decreasing the proportion of the old diet over a period of several days.

Adhering to these nutritional guidelines can promote enhanced performance, improved recovery, and sustained health in working canines. Tailoring dietary strategies to individual needs and activity levels ensures optimal well-being.

1. Elevated Protein Content

1. Elevated Protein Content, Dog

Elevated protein content is a cornerstone of nutritional formulations designed for hunting dogs. The intense physical demands of hunting, including prolonged running, tracking, and retrieving, necessitate a diet that supports both muscle maintenance and repair. Insufficient protein intake can lead to muscle atrophy, reduced stamina, and increased susceptibility to injury. Consequently, specialized canine diets prioritize high-quality protein sources to offset these potential detriments. The physiological basis for this lies in the role of amino acids, the building blocks of protein, in facilitating muscle protein synthesis and preventing muscle protein breakdown during periods of intense exertion.

Real-world examples underscore the significance of adequate protein intake. Hunting dogs fed diets lacking sufficient protein often exhibit decreased performance, slower recovery times, and a greater incidence of muscle-related injuries. Conversely, dogs receiving protein-rich diets tend to maintain optimal muscle mass, exhibit enhanced endurance, and recover more rapidly after strenuous activity. This is particularly evident in breeds like Labrador Retrievers and German Shorthaired Pointers, which are commonly employed in hunting roles. Monitoring a dog’s body condition score can assist with maintaining the dog’s health.

In summary, elevated protein content is not merely an additive but a fundamental requirement for working canines engaged in hunting. Its impact on muscle physiology, performance, and overall well-being is substantial. Addressing the challenges of meeting these elevated protein needs requires careful selection of high-quality protein sources and appropriate dietary formulations. This principle links directly to the broader theme of optimizing canine nutrition to support peak performance and longevity in demanding working roles.

2. Concentrated Energy Sources

2. Concentrated Energy Sources, Dog

Diets formulated for hunting dogs incorporate concentrated energy sources, primarily in the form of fats, to meet the heightened metabolic demands associated with sustained physical activity. The causal relationship between energy expenditure and dietary provision is direct; hunting activities necessitate greater caloric intake than sedentary lifestyles. The importance of concentrated energy stems from its role in providing readily available fuel for muscular exertion, thermoregulation, and cellular function. Insufficient energy intake results in diminished performance, fatigue, and compromised immune function. For example, during a multi-day hunting expedition, a dog expends significantly more calories than during a typical day at rest. Formulations containing higher fat percentages provide a compact source of energy to sustain activity levels without requiring excessive food volume.

The practical application of this understanding is evident in the formulation of specialized diets tailored to the specific energy needs of different hunting breeds and hunting styles. Breeds like the Pointer, which rely on bursts of high-speed running, benefit from diets rich in rapidly metabolizable fats. Retrievers, engaged in sustained swimming and retrieving, require a sustained energy release provided by a blend of fats and complex carbohydrates. The choice of fat source is also critical; animal fats provide essential fatty acids that contribute to coat health and hormone production, further supporting the dog’s overall physiological well-being. Practical implications include careful monitoring of body condition score and adjusting dietary intake based on activity levels and environmental conditions.

In summary, concentrated energy sources are an indispensable component of diets designed for hunting dogs. Their presence directly impacts performance, endurance, and overall health. The challenge lies in balancing caloric density with digestibility and palatability to ensure optimal nutrient absorption and prevent gastrointestinal distress. The optimization of energy provision is inextricably linked to the broader theme of supporting canine athletes in demanding working environments. The careful selection of ingredients is paramount.

3. Joint Support Supplements

3. Joint Support Supplements, Dog

Hunting dogs, due to the rigorous physical demands of their activities, are predisposed to joint stress and degradation. The repetitive impact and forceful movements associated with running, jumping, and navigating uneven terrain accelerate the wear and tear on articular cartilage. Consequently, joint support supplements are frequently incorporated into specialized diets to mitigate these effects and promote long-term joint health. The inclusion of these supplements aims to address the underlying causes of joint deterioration, primarily inflammation and cartilage breakdown, rather than simply masking symptoms. A deficiency in joint support can lead to diminished mobility, chronic pain, and potentially, career-ending injuries. For example, many hunting dog breeds are prone to hip dysplasia, which can be exacerbated by high-impact activities. Supplements can play a role in managing the progression of this condition.

Common joint support supplements found in formulations include glucosamine, chondroitin sulfate, and omega-3 fatty acids. Glucosamine and chondroitin are thought to support the synthesis of glycosaminoglycans, essential components of cartilage matrix, thereby promoting cartilage repair and regeneration. Omega-3 fatty acids possess anti-inflammatory properties, reducing joint pain and stiffness. The effectiveness of these supplements is, however, dependent on factors such as dosage, bioavailability, and the dog’s individual physiology. Careful consideration should be given to the source and quality of supplements to ensure optimal absorption and efficacy. Furthermore, dietary formulations often include antioxidants, such as Vitamin E and selenium, to combat oxidative stress, a contributing factor to joint inflammation.

In conclusion, the inclusion of joint support supplements in the diets of hunting dogs represents a proactive approach to mitigating the risks associated with high-impact activities. These supplements target the underlying mechanisms of joint degeneration, aiming to preserve joint function and prolong the working life of canine athletes. Challenges remain in determining optimal dosages and ensuring supplement quality, necessitating a collaborative approach between veterinarians, nutritionists, and dog owners. 4. Optimal Digestive Health

4. Optimal Digestive Health, Dog

In the context of canine athletes, specifically hunting dogs, optimal digestive health assumes a paramount position, intrinsically linked to performance, nutrient absorption, and overall well-being. Efficient digestion ensures that ingested nutrients are effectively processed and utilized, providing the energy and building blocks necessary for sustained physical exertion. Digestive distress, conversely, can lead to malabsorption, reduced energy levels, and compromised immune function, directly impacting a dog’s ability to perform its duties in the field. The formulation of specialized diets addresses these concerns by prioritizing ingredients and processing methods that promote digestive efficiency and minimize the risk of gastrointestinal upset.

  • High-Quality Protein Digestibility

    Protein digestibility directly influences the availability of amino acids for muscle repair and maintenance. Canine diets formulated for optimal digestive health utilize highly digestible protein sources, such as hydrolyzed proteins or specific animal-derived proteins with proven digestibility scores. For example, a diet incorporating chicken meal as a primary protein source, processed to enhance digestibility, supports efficient protein absorption and reduces the likelihood of intestinal inflammation, compared to diets relying on less digestible plant-based proteins.

  • Fiber Balance

    Dietary fiber plays a crucial role in regulating intestinal transit time and promoting a healthy gut microbiome. Specialized formulations incorporate a balance of soluble and insoluble fiber to support stool consistency and prevent digestive issues. For instance, the inclusion of beet pulp, a moderate fiber source, aids in maintaining intestinal motility and absorbing excess water in the colon, thereby preventing both diarrhea and constipation, common ailments in working dogs subjected to dietary changes or environmental stressors.

  • Prebiotics and Probiotics

    Prebiotics and probiotics contribute to a balanced gut microbiome, enhancing nutrient absorption and bolstering immune defenses. Prebiotics, such as fructooligosaccharides (FOS), provide nourishment for beneficial bacteria in the gut, while probiotics introduce live microorganisms to promote a healthy microbial population. For example, supplementing a hunting dog’s diet with Enterococcus faecium, a probiotic strain, can improve digestive efficiency and reduce the incidence of antibiotic-associated diarrhea, particularly relevant for dogs exposed to potential pathogens in outdoor environments.

  • Minimization of Artificial Additives

    Artificial additives, such as artificial colors, flavors, and preservatives, can potentially disrupt the delicate balance of the gut microbiome and trigger allergic reactions, leading to digestive upset. Formulations designed for optimal digestive health prioritize natural ingredients and minimize the use of artificial additives. An example of this would be a canned dog food using only natural preservatives, such as Vitamin E, instead of artificial preservatives such as BHA or BHT, promoting better digestive health and nutrient absorption.

The integration of these facets into the formulation of canine diets represents a holistic approach to promoting optimal digestive health in hunting dogs. By prioritizing highly digestible ingredients, balancing fiber content, supporting a healthy gut microbiome, and minimizing artificial additives, specialized diets can significantly enhance nutrient absorption, reduce the risk of digestive disorders, and contribute to sustained performance and overall well-being. These factors, while individually significant, collectively contribute to the robustness and resilience of the canine digestive system, enabling hunting dogs to effectively utilize nutrients and maintain peak physical condition in demanding working environments. 5. Performance Enhancement Ingredients

5. Performance Enhancement Ingredients, Dog

The inclusion of specific performance enhancement ingredients in diets formulated for hunting dogs aims to optimize physiological function beyond basic nutritional requirements. These additives are selected to address the unique demands of hunting activities, supporting stamina, focus, and recovery. Formulations go beyond standard nutrition profiles.

  • Medium-Chain Triglycerides (MCTs)

    MCTs are a rapidly metabolized source of energy, providing a readily available fuel source for sustained activity. Unlike long-chain triglycerides, MCTs are absorbed directly into the bloodstream, bypassing the need for lymphatic transport. This rapid absorption allows for quick energy release during periods of intense exertion. For instance, the addition of coconut oil, rich in MCTs, to a hunting dog’s diet can improve endurance and reduce fatigue during long hunts. This translates to maintained performance over prolonged durations.

  • L-Carnitine

    L-Carnitine plays a crucial role in fatty acid metabolism, facilitating the transport of fatty acids into the mitochondria for energy production. By enhancing fatty acid utilization, L-Carnitine promotes efficient energy generation and reduces reliance on glycogen stores. Supplementation with L-Carnitine can improve exercise performance and reduce muscle damage in hunting dogs engaged in strenuous activity. An example would be a hunting dog able to sustain speed for a longer period. Dietary inclusion can optimize these outcomes.

  • Antioxidants (Vitamin E, Selenium, Vitamin C)

    Hunting activities generate oxidative stress due to increased metabolic activity and exposure to environmental stressors. Antioxidants, such as Vitamin E, Selenium, and Vitamin C, neutralize free radicals and mitigate oxidative damage to cells and tissues. The inclusion of antioxidants in a hunting dog’s diet protects against muscle damage, reduces inflammation, and supports immune function. A hunting dog on a diet rich in antioxidants may exhibit reduced recovery time and improved overall health. This is beneficial during hunting season.

  • Branched-Chain Amino Acids (BCAAs)

    BCAAs, including leucine, isoleucine, and valine, play a critical role in muscle protein synthesis and reducing muscle protein breakdown during exercise. Supplementation with BCAAs can promote muscle repair, reduce muscle soreness, and improve exercise performance in hunting dogs. This is of benefit for breeds known to get sore quickly. BCAAs contribute to improved recovery and maintenance.

These performance enhancement ingredients represent targeted interventions to optimize specific physiological functions relevant to hunting performance. Their inclusion in specialized diets aims to enhance stamina, focus, recovery, and overall well-being in working canines. The careful selection and appropriate dosage of these ingredients, guided by scientific evidence and veterinary consultation, are crucial for maximizing their benefits and minimizing potential risks. Diets formulated with these components help ensure that hunting dogs are able to maintain optimal performance throughout the rigors of training and hunting seasons. These additives are most effective in a complete and balanced diet.

Frequently Asked Questions about Canine Hunting Nutrition

The following questions address common inquiries regarding the specific dietary needs of canines engaged in hunting activities, providing clarity on optimal nutritional strategies.

Question 1: What distinguishes dietary requirements of hunting dogs from those of sedentary breeds?

The metabolic demands of hunting dogs far exceed those of sedentary breeds due to increased physical exertion. Diets must contain higher levels of protein and fat to support muscle maintenance, repair, and sustained energy release.

Question 2: How significant is protein content in specialized canine hunting diets?

Protein is of critical importance, as it provides the essential amino acids necessary for muscle development and repair. Hunting dogs require a diet with a higher protein percentage to support their increased muscle mass and activity levels.

Question 3: What role do fats play in the diets of hunting canines?

Fats serve as a concentrated energy source, fueling prolonged physical activity. Furthermore, specific fatty acids, such as omega-3s, contribute to joint health and coat condition, important for dogs exposed to varied environmental conditions.

Question 4: Are dietary supplements necessary for hunting dogs, or can a balanced diet suffice?

While a balanced diet forms the foundation of canine nutrition, certain supplements, such as glucosamine and chondroitin, may provide additional support for joint health, given the stresses placed on joints during hunting activities. Consultation with a veterinarian is recommended before introducing supplements.

Question 5: How does timing of meals affect a hunting dog’s performance?

Strategic meal timing is important. Meals should be provided several hours before or after periods of intense activity to optimize digestion and energy availability. Feeding immediately prior to exertion can increase the risk of bloat and digestive upset.

Question 6: What are the signs of inadequate nutrition in a hunting dog?

Signs may include decreased stamina, muscle loss, poor coat condition, and increased susceptibility to injury. Regular monitoring of body condition score and veterinary check-ups are essential for identifying and addressing nutritional deficiencies.

In summary, the nutritional needs of hunting dogs are distinctly different from those of less active canines. Meeting these needs requires a carefully formulated diet rich in protein, fats, and essential nutrients, potentially supplemented with joint support and other performance-enhancing ingredients.
